Nice soft look. I like the white drape. The exposure was just right for the white drape. I don't know, maybe the face could come up just a little bit. I think that I would try to retouch some of the blemishes on the face and arms. I like the composition and balance. It keeps me within the frame of the picture. Title good! The more I look at this the more I like it. If this was sharpened, it was just right.

Nice soft capture of a pensive moment. I like the lighting and the juxtaposition of the white curtain with the dark shadow. I wonder if the shadows were lightened just enough to bring some detail in her hair if this would have been even better. Well done.
